How is prokaryotic cell different from a cell ? |
| Answer» \t\xa0Prokaryotic cellEukaryotic cell1. Size : generally small ( 1-10 µm) Where 1 µm = 10-6m1. Size: generally large ( 5-100 µm)2. Nuclear region: It is not well defined and known as nucleoid.2. Nuclear region: well defined and surrounded by a nuclear membrane3. Chromosome: single3. More than one chromosome4. Membrane-bound cell organelles absent4. Membrane-bound cell organelles are present.\t | |
